44-Unit Group Dwelling in Smith Bay Applies for Permit Approval

  • fave
  • like
  • share

A virtual public hearing was held for the construction of 44 two three-bedroom units in Smith Bay on St. Thomas. The Department of Planning and Natural Resources' Division of Comprehensive and Coastal Zone Planning presented the dwelling permit application to the public for parcel numbers 19-C-A and 19-C-B Estate Smith Bay, numbers 1, 2 and 3 East End Quarter.
